NI PXIe-4082 – 6.5‑Digit DMM & LCR Meter for PXI Express Precision Test
The NI PXIe-4082 packs a full-featured 6.5‑digit digital multimeter and an LCR meter into a single 3U PXI Express slot. From my experience, it’s the go-to choice when you want bench-grade measurements inside an automated PXI system without burning extra slots or budget on separate instruments. You get classic DMM functions (DC/AC V and I, 2‑wire/4‑wire resistance, diode, frequency) plus L/C/R measurements with selectable test conditions—ideal for component characterization, inline validation, and mixed-signal ATE where footprint matters.

Key Features
- DMM + LCR in one slot – Consolidates measurement capability, which typically reduces test time and cabling complexity.
- 6.5‑digit resolution – Stable low-noise readings for precision DC, AC, and resistance measurements.
- LCR measurement capability – Characterize capacitors and inductors (and derived parameters like D/Q/ESR) with selectable test conditions; in many cases, this replaces a standalone benchtop LCR meter.
- 2‑wire and 4‑wire resistance – 4‑wire mode minimizes lead effects for low‑ohms work, typically crucial in sensor and shunt evaluations.
- PXI Express integration – Tight timing/synchronization over the PXI Express backplane trigger lines for multi‑instrument systems.
- Software flexibility – Supported by NI‑DMM driver; works with LabVIEW, LabWindows/CVI, C/C++, and .NET, which makes scripting test steps straightforward.
- Self-calibration and system calibration support – Helps maintain accuracy across temperature changes; a practical advantage in production labs.

Installation & Maintenance
- Chassis & environment – Install in a 3U PXI Express chassis with unobstructed airflow. Maintain ambient 0–55 °C and keep intake/exhaust clear.
- Wiring & shielding – Use low-thermal EMF leads for microvolt work and twisted/shielded leads for low‑ohms. For 4‑wire resistance, route sense leads separately to avoid coupling.
- Warm‑up – Allow a typical 30‑minute warm‑up for best accuracy before final measurements.
- Self‑cal & external cal – Run self‑cal after large temperature changes. Plan external calibration approximately every 2 years, or sooner for accredited production lines.
- LCR tips – Keep lead length short, use proper fixtures, and select appropriate test frequency to avoid parasitics dominating high‑Q parts.
- Software/firmware – Keep NI‑DMM driver and firmware current via NI Package Manager to benefit from fixes and performance updates.
- Safety – Observe input terminal ratings. De‑energize circuits before re-terminating; verify the selected function and range to prevent overload.
